在使用Clash Verge等代理工具时,DNS泄露是一个需要关注的重要问题。本文将为您详细解析DNS泄露的含义、在Clash Verge中的表现,以及如何采取措施防止DNS泄露,保护您的隐私和数据安全。
DNS(域名系统)是将人类可读的域名(如example.com
)转换为IP地址的系统。当您访问某个网站时,设备会通过DNS服务器查询对应的IP地址。
Clash Verge是一款基于规则的代理工具,支持多种协议。DNS泄露可能在以下情况下发生:
以下是防止DNS泄露的具体方法:
config.yaml
)中正确配置DNS,示例如下:dns:
enable: true
listen: 127.0.0.1:53
enhanced-mode: redir-host
nameserver:
- 1.1.1.1
- 8.8.8.8
enable: true
:启用Clash DNS。listen
:监听的本地地址和端口。enhanced-mode
:建议使用redir-host
模式以提高解析效率。nameserver
:配置可信赖的DNS服务器,如Cloudflare(1.1.1.1)或Google(8.8.8.8)。在操作系统中手动禁用默认DNS设置,确保所有DNS请求都通过Clash:
resolv.conf
或网络管理器配置。在某些特殊网络中,可以通过DNS劫持功能强制将所有DNS请求引导到Clash处理。例如:
dns:
fallback-filter:
geoip: true
ipcidr:
- 0.0.0.0/0
- "::/0"
使用以下工具验证是否存在DNS泄露:
通过这些工具检测是否有请求绕过了Clash的DNS。
确保您的Clash Verge软件和订阅规则始终为最新版本,以避免因旧版本配置漏洞导致的DNS泄露。
DNS泄露是使用代理或VPN时必须关注的重要问题,特别是在保护隐私的场景中。通过正确配置Clash Verge的DNS设置、禁用系统默认DNS以及测试和验证配置,可以有效防止DNS泄露。为确保您的浏览活动安全且隐私,请定期检查配置,并根据网络环境调整设置。
4/5 - (1 vote)